引言
在当今互联网时代,GitHub已经成为程序员和开发者们的一个重要工具。它不仅是一个代码托管平台,更是一个开发者社群。然而,许多人在使用GitHub时都会遇到一个问题:GitHub登录太难。本文将深入探讨这一问题的原因及相应的解决方案。
GitHub登录的复杂性
登录流程
GitHub登录的流程看似简单,但实际上却可能因为多个因素而变得复杂。用户需要提供有效的邮箱和密码,如果启用了两步验证,用户还需要输入验证码。
常见问题
- 密码错误:输入密码时,容易由于大小写、特殊字符等导致输入错误。
- 账号被锁定:由于多次输入错误,可能导致账号被暂时锁定。
- 验证码问题:如果未能及时收到验证码,用户可能会无法完成登录。
为什么会有这些问题?
1. 复杂的安全机制
为了保护用户的账号安全,GitHub采用了多重验证机制。这虽然提升了安全性,但也增加了登录的复杂度。
2. 用户习惯问题
许多用户在使用GitHub时,可能未曾注意到密码的复杂要求。例如,某些用户可能习惯于使用简单密码,从而导致登录失败。
3. 网络问题
有时,网络不稳定也会导致登录过程中的问题。用户可能会遇到超时或连接失败的情况。
GitHub登录的解决方案
1. 重置密码
如果遇到密码错误,可以尝试使用“忘记密码”功能来重置密码。重置后,确保新密码符合要求,通常建议:
- 包含至少8个字符
- 包含大小写字母
- 包含数字
- 包含特殊字符
2. 检查邮箱
确保使用的是与GitHub账号绑定的有效邮箱。如果无法收到验证码,请检查邮箱的垃圾邮件文件夹。
3. 两步验证
如果启用了两步验证,确保手机或认证应用能正常工作。如果使用短信验证码,确认网络信号良好。
4. 使用密码管理工具
使用密码管理器可以帮助用户生成和保存复杂密码,避免输入错误。
GitHub登录的常见问答
Q1: 为什么我无法登录GitHub?
答:登录失败可能是由于密码错误、账号被锁定或网络问题。请逐一排查这些因素,确保信息输入正确。
Q2: 如何重置GitHub密码?
答:在登录页面点击“忘记密码”,然后根据提示输入注册时的邮箱。系统会发送重置链接到该邮箱。
Q3: GitHub的两步验证是什么?
答:两步验证是一种额外的安全措施,在输入密码后需要再输入一组验证码,通常通过短信或认证应用发送。
Q4: 如何解决验证码无法收到的问题?
答:请检查手机信号是否正常,确保电话号码填写正确。如果依然收不到,可以尝试通过认证应用获取验证码。
结论
总的来说,GitHub登录太难并非没有解决方案。通过了解登录过程中可能遇到的问题,并采取适当的解决措施,用户能够更加顺利地登录GitHub。希望本文能够帮助到每一位遇到登录难题的用户,顺利使用GitHub这个强大的工具。